Star Wars Battlefront II gets The Last Jedi season and single-player expansion

Finn joins the battle as a playable hero for the Resistance while Captain Phasma is playable as a new villain leading the First Order. Both characters can be unlocked without credits by simply logging in during the season. The free update also adds new locations. The Battle on Crait is a new Galactic Assault match and D'Qar is a small, intense Starfighter Assault arena.

That's not all though: In The Last Jedi season, players must choose to fight for the Resistance or the First Order. According to EA, this choice will be linked to recurring Challenges that rewards players on both the individual and faction levels.

A small single-player expansion is also available for free with The Last Jedi season. In Star Wars Battlefront II: Resurrection, gamers can continue Iden Versio's journey through the First Order's rise to power. Taking place after completion of the single-player campaign, Iden returns to search for answers in three new chapters. In her pursuit, she uncovers secrets of the First Order, which lead to the events of Star Wars: The Last Jedi.

In Star Wars Battlefront II, you embark on an action experience in the acclaimed universe. Iconic characters like Darth Maul, Han Solo, and Kylo Ren make an appearance in this game and there are plenty of other surprises across its campaign and multiplayer modes. The title is currently available on Xbox One, Windows PC, and PlayStation 4. The game also achieves native 4K resolution on Xbox One X.
